Transaction 33079aafda2e97f177f300fe59d597177be676cfacb8400fb8ca8008224abb4a
1 Input
1 Output
-
33079aafda2e97f177f300fe59d597177be676cfacb8400fb8ca8008224abb4a:0
- value
- 997320
- script pubkey
- OP_0 OP_PUSHBYTES_20 167b2c0ed9ea1ba738133dd41344c192c662fb8b
- address
- bc1qzeajcrkeagd6wwqn8h2px3xpjtrx97utk38c8h